Franchise agreements vary between different franchises, but these seven areas should be addressed in every franchise agreement. Use of Trademarks. Location of the Franchise. Term of the Franchise. Franchisees Fees and Other Payments. Obligations and Duties of the Franchisor. Restriction on Goods and Services Offered.

The following are the steps to franchise your business: Determine if franchising is right for your business. Issue your franchise disclosure document. Prepare your operations manual. Register your trademarks. Establish your franchise company. Register and file your FDD. Create your franchise sales strategy and budget.
A franchise agreement incorporates the rights and obligations of the franchisor and franchisee to license and sell a companys intellectual property and licensing rights. Examples of businesses that use franchise agreements include: Convenience stores. Fast food and chain restaurants.
One of the most important elements of a franchise agreement is the right to use the franchisors trademark. The franchisor must register the trademark and have the exclusive right to use it. The franchisor must specify in the contract the word symbol or symbol for which the trademark is registered or applied for.

A franchise agreement should include clauses pertaining to location, duration, operation, fees, and use of intellectual property. However, basic knowledge would not suffice to conclude such an important contract, and professional legal advice is necessary.
